“Culture. Industry. Technology.” is a forum for members of creative industries which used to be an event of technical direction and used to be called “Technology Day” for its first three years of existence has grown into an event of wider scope and objectives. For the first time, this year the event will be organized in cooperation with “Latvian Music Development Association/Latvian Music Export” and will cover a longer list of topics. The forum will take place on 23 September at culture venue Hanzas Perons. This year’s central topic is creativity and functionality – how to use technologic tools smart in order to achieve maximally creative outcome, retaining balance of ideas and possibilities. The three most important forum happenings will be devoted to this topic.

One of the central events of the forum is speech by Peggy Eisenhauer – a light and stage design artist from the U.S. She has been several times awarded with Tony award and has been nominated for numerous Broadway productions. She has created lighting solutions and stage design for more than 40 plays, has been working as lighting designer in Hollywood; her most popular work is screen adaptation of “Chicago”.

Another interesting happening at the forum will be an open discussion “KIT talk” about functionality of concert halls and houses of culture in Latvia. Discussion members will analyse both already existing and future objects of state significance from the point of view of their suitability for holding events according to the creative and technical support companies.

Music makers and producers will definitely appreciate speech by Magdalena Jensen, Head of Marketing and Baltics and Poland Regional Printing House at digital distribution platform The Orchard. The Orchard was founded in 1997 with the aim to provide independent artists the ability to sell their music to mainstream audiences. Over 20 years of its existence it has grown from a small New York-based company to a global industry leader. Their slogan is “Distribution done right” and it is going to be the topic of Magdalena’s speech.
